Understanding the Importance of National Holidays
Cultural Significance
National holidays often celebrate historical events, cultural milestones, or the achievements of a nation. By understanding the background of these holidays, you can appreciate the reasons behind the celebrations and participate more meaningfully.
Language Learning Opportunities
Celebrating national holidays in English provides a practical context for learning new vocabulary, phrases, and idioms related to the holiday’s theme. It also allows you to practice listening, speaking, reading, and writing skills in a real-life scenario.
Preparing for Early Celebrations
Researching the Holiday
Before you start celebrating, research the national holiday you’re interested in. Learn about its history, traditions, and symbols. This will help you understand the context and significance of the holiday.
Gathering Resources
Collect materials that can help you celebrate the holiday in English. This could include books, videos, music, and online resources. For example, if you’re celebrating Independence Day, you might gather patriotic songs, historical documents, and flag-related items.
Inviting English Speakers
If possible, invite English-speaking friends or family members to join in the celebrations. This will provide you with an opportunity to practice your language skills in a relaxed and enjoyable setting.

Using English Phrases
Here are some phrases you can use to celebrate national holidays in English:
- Happy Independence Day!
- Let’s celebrate our nation’s birthday with pride and joy!
- Wishing you a festive and memorable holiday!
- We’re grateful for the freedoms and opportunities our country provides.
